    Development of a GPS Active Control Point Station

    Source: Journal of Surveying Engineering:;1989:;Volume ( 115 ):;issue: 001

    Abstract: The Geodetic Survey Division, Canada Centre for Surveying, has embarked on the implementation of the Active Control System, a project to establish a nationwide network of automated Global Positioning System (GPS) tracking stations, or
